I've just moved to nmh-0.21 and I have a question about decode.

I notice in the sample mhl.* and format files, decode is only used on
some headers (for instance, mhl.format decodes From and Subject, but
not To or cc). Is there a reason not to just make it global in the
mhl.* files?  And if not, is there a way to make it decode all
headers in general format files?  I really don't receive much mail
with encoded headers, so it's not a big deal for me, but I'm curious.

On an unrelated side-note, I also noticed that "automimeproc" is not
in the mh-profile man page, and it's use is sort of unlike the other
*proc settings, so it could stand some explanation.

Since this is the first release of nmh which does RFC-2047 decoding
of header fields, I wanted to start conservatively.  More fields will
probably be decoded by default in the future.
